Rockafeller spent her childhood in an environment permeated by music due to the fact that both her father and her brother, Terry Paholek, were actively involved in the music scene in Edmonton and owned their own home studio. She moved into a group home when she was 15 years old, and that is when she started rapping.

She was at a party with some other rappers when they came up with the idea that she needed a new name. They came up with the pseudonym “Nova Rockafeller,” and they gave it to her. Rockafeller was reared in Jamaica; she spent a quarter of the year there from the age of 3 to 9 years old and lived there full-time from the age of 9 to 14 after her family began a water sports business there. Rockafeller was born in Edmonton, although she was raised in Jamaica.

She also spent a short time living in the city of Toronto and in the city of New York. When she was a teenager, she quit high school and started rapping during a challenging time in her life that was spent sleeping at the Edmonton Youth Emergency Shelter and living in a succession of group homes. During this time, she was moved around a lot.

Her ex-boyfriend was the one who initially sparked her interest in rapping and led her to explore the online battle rap communities. Rockafeller relocated to New York and obtained a recording contract with Mercury Records when the record label took notice of her.

The record label would eventually evolve into Island Records, and then Def Jam after that. After three and a half years of working together, her contract with Def Jam was terminated when the firm fired her without prior notice. The news came to her attention when her landlord informed her that the corporation would no longer be responsible for paying her rent. Rockafeller had been working on an album titled Accidentally Gangster before the label decided to drop her as a recording artist; however, the project was scrapped.

Rockefeller introduced her jewelry collection titled “Toys on Chains” in the year 2012. Rockafeller started to make a name for herself in the mainstream music industry in 2015, while she was still signed to Def Jam. She did this with her track “Made in Gold” which made it into the top 20 on Sirius Top Hits. The teen comedy film “The Duff” incorporated the track in one of its scenes.

In addition, her music has been heard on the television shows Siesta Keys, Dancing with the Stars, and Bad Girls Club. During that same year, she performed at SXSW, Riot Fest, and the Gathering of the Juggalos in addition to touring with Set it Off and All Time Low. Rockafeller has been linked to the Insane Clown Posse and the Juggalo movement ever since she made an appearance at the Gathering. She also gave a performance at Violent J and Lil Eazy E’s first solo charity tour together.

In 2017, Rockafeller started a relationship with Tom MacDonald, a Canadian rapper. They collaborated to form the band GFBF and began the songwriting process. Rockafeller threw her full weight behind Macdonald and his work after the publication of “Dear Rappers” and his subsequent rise to fame. She shot and directed all of his music videos released after 2017, developed his website, co-wrote hooks, and assisted him in navigating the music industry and avoiding the problems she encountered in the industry herself.
